Jetblue Airways (JBLU) Assets (2016 - 2025)
Jetblue Airways (JBLU) has disclosed Assets for 17 consecutive years, with $16.6 billion as the latest value for Q4 2025.
- On a quarterly basis, Assets fell 1.61% to $16.6 billion in Q4 2025 year-over-year; TTM through Dec 2025 was $16.6 billion, a 1.61% decrease, with the full-year FY2025 number at $16.6 billion, down 1.61% from a year prior.
- Assets was $16.6 billion for Q4 2025 at Jetblue Airways, roughly flat from $16.6 billion in the prior quarter.
- In the past five years, Assets ranged from a high of $17.1 billion in Q1 2025 to a low of $13.0 billion in Q4 2022.

- Jetblue Airways' Assets stood at $13.6 billion in 2021, then decreased by 4.38% to $13.0 billion in 2022, then increased by 6.19% to $13.9 billion in 2023, then grew by 21.57% to $16.8 billion in 2024, then decreased by 1.61% to $16.6 billion in 2025.
